The Shenji Camp in the Ming Dynasty was a firearm unit, and it was the only one in the world. The Shenji Camp was built in the Yongle period of the Ming Dynasty. At that time, Zhu Di formed three major camps in the Jingying camp, including the Five Military Camp, the Three Thousand Camp and the Shenji Camp. When the three major camps were first established, they were quite combat-effective, but the main force was exhausted in the transformation of Tumu. During the Jingtai period, Yu Qian, the Minister of War, reformed the organization of the Jingying camp and selected 100,000 elite troops from the three major camps. They were divided into 100,000 troops to train in order to prepare for emergency calls, and were called the 10th regiment.
Later, emperors of various dynasties made many reforms to the regiment camp, but basically continued the scale of the 10th battalion. Only in the 29th year of Jiajing, the regiment camp and the two official halls were abolished, and the old system of the three major camps in Yongle period was restored. The difference was that the Sanqian camp was renamed Shenshu camp.
Of course, this is Beijing Jingying. Nanjing Jingying is different from Beijing Jingying. There are no Five Military Camps and Three Thousand Camps, only Shenji Camps are left. They are also responsible for training the shift officers of Nanjing garrisons in large and small teaching grounds.
